Single celled animals are said to be immortal because

A

they grow indefinitely in size

B

they can tolerate any degree of change in temperature

C

they can reproduce throughtout their life span

D

they continue to live as their daughter cells.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
d

No individual is immortal except some single-celled organisms (e.g., Amoeba). It is due to the fact that they divide and continue to live as their daughter cells.
